Where Container Houses Make Sense
Container houses earn their keep in applications where speed and relocatability matter more than permanent architectural expression. Common uses include construction site offices, temporary staff accommodation, site canteens, guard houses, and remote work camps. They also appear in agricultural storage, small retail kiosks, and emergency housing. The common thread is a need for enclosed, secure space delivered quickly and moved or expanded later without demolishing anything.

If your project requires a permanent building with complex foundations, heavy services, or strict local building codes, a container house may still work, but you will need to confirm engineering details with the supplier and local authorities. The product is not a universal replacement for conventional construction; it is a modular alternative that shines when time and flexibility are the priorities.
What Actually Differs between Container House Types
Not all container houses are the same. The most meaningful differences are in the frame, the wall panels, and the degree of prefabrication.

- Frame type: Some units use a welded steel frame similar to a shipping container; others use a lighter modular frame designed only for static placement. The heavier frame suits stacking and repeated lifting, while the lighter frame reduces cost and weight for single-story use.
- Wall and roof panels: Sandwich panels with foam or rock wool insulation affect thermal performance, fire resistance, and acoustic comfort. Rock wool generally offers better fire performance, while foam is lighter and cheaper. Confirm the core material and density with the supplier.
- Prefabrication level: A fully fitted unit arrives with doors, windows, electrical wiring, and plumbing installed. A flat-pack version ships as panels and requires on-site assembly. The trade-off is factory quality and speed versus shipping volume and site labor.
These differences drive both price and performance. A cheap unit with thin panels may be fine for a storage shed but uncomfortable for living quarters. Match the specification to the actual use, not to the lowest quote.
Cost Drivers and Budget Reality
Container house pricing depends on size, materials, insulation type, interior fit-out, and the number of doors and windows. Customization—such as adding a toilet, air conditioning, or special electrical layouts—adds cost. Shipping distance and site access also matter: a unit that must travel far or be lifted into place costs more than one delivered on a flatbed to a clear site.

Do not assume that the cheapest quote is the best value. Ask the supplier for a breakdown of the frame steel thickness, panel composition, and included fittings. A slightly higher price often buys a stronger frame and better insulation, which reduces long-term maintenance and energy costs.
Limitations and Failure Risks
Container houses have real limitations. Without proper ventilation, condensation can form inside, especially in humid climates. Insulation quality directly affects comfort; poor panels make the unit too hot in summer and too cold in winter. The steel frame can corrode if the protective coating is damaged or if the unit sits in a saline or coastal environment. Also, stacking units requires a structural design that accounts for wind load and foundation stability—do not assume any unit can be stacked without engineering review.
Buyers should also check the floor load rating and the roof load capacity, especially if the unit will support solar panels or a second story. These are not standard across all suppliers, so confirm the numbers in writing.
Supplier Verification Checklist
Because container houses are factory-made, the supplier’s quality control is your quality control. Before ordering, verify the following:
- Ask for the steel grade and thickness used in the frame, and the panel core material and density.
- Request photos or videos of the production line and a sample unit if possible.
- Confirm the lead time and the shipping method, including whether the unit is fully assembled or flat-packed.
- Check the warranty terms and what they cover—frame, panels, or fittings.
- Ask for reference projects or customer testimonials that match your application.
If the supplier cannot provide clear technical specifications, treat that as a red flag. A reliable manufacturer will be transparent about materials and processes.
Project Planning and Customization
Plan the site before you order. The unit needs a level foundation—concrete pads or a steel base—and clear access for delivery. If you need multiple units, decide whether they will be placed side by side or stacked, and confirm the supplier’s design for connecting them. Customization is possible, but it adds lead time. Order early if you need special layouts, colors, or additional openings.
Also consider the local climate. In hot regions, specify thicker insulation and ventilation options. In cold regions, ask about heating provisions and condensation control. The supplier can advise, but you must provide the site conditions.
Frequently Asked Questions
How Long Does a Container House Last?
Lifespan depends on the steel quality, coating, and maintenance. A well-maintained unit with a proper foundation and regular repainting can last many years, but the exact figure varies by supplier and environment. Ask the manufacturer for their expected service life and maintenance recommendations.
Can Container Houses Be Moved after Installation?
Yes, but moving a unit requires lifting equipment and transport, and it may damage the structure if not designed for repeated relocation. Confirm with the supplier whether the unit is rated for multiple lifts or intended for semi-permanent placement.
